C2 Proficiency A2 Flyers Young Learners 100 About Pre A1 Starters Pre A1 Starters, A1 Movers and A2 Flyers is a series of fun, motivating English language exams for children in primary and lower secondary education. The exams are an excellent way for children to gain confidence and improve their English. There are three levels of exam:
